Irregular is not unexpected

Christmas is on the same date every year and the car needs a service every year, yet both regularly arrive as a shock. A sinking fund is just the bill divided by the months until it lands.

Common funds: car maintenance, insurance renewals, annual subscriptions, gifts, holidays, dental and medical costs, home repairs, and replacing a phone or laptop.

Money set aside a little at a time for a cost you know is coming, like a car service, a holiday or an insurance renewal. It differs from an emergency fund in that the expense is expected, so both the amount and the date can be planned.
Anything irregular that is not a true emergency: car maintenance, annual insurance and subscriptions, gifts and holidays, medical and dental costs, home repairs, and replacing things like a phone or laptop. The plan starts with last year's statements to find yours.
No. Some banks let you create named pots, which makes the balances easy to see, but one savings account and a simple record of how much belongs to each fund works just as well.
